Abstract
The invention discloses a novel traction type garlic seeder, which comprises a driving assembly and a garlic seed conveying assembly, wherein the driving assembly comprises a driving wheel, one side of the driving wheel is provided with a rotary cultivator, one side of the rotary cultivator is provided with a soil pressing wheel, the top of the soil pressing wheel is provided with a soil shoveling plate, the garlic seed conveying assembly comprises a garlic box, the bottom of the garlic box is provided with a garlic seed staying area, a seed taking device is arranged on the garlic seed staying area and is connected with an exhaust pipe, the exhaust pipe is connected with the exhaust box, the exhaust box is connected with the exhaust fan, one side of the exhaust fan is provided with an air pump, one side of the seed taking device is provided with a garlic sowing brush, one side of the garlic sowing brush is provided with a garlic guiding groove, the garlic guiding groove is connected with a connecting rod through a first duckbill of garlic Guan Lianjie, one side of the seed taking device is provided with a disturbance plate, and the lower end of the seed taking device is connected with a crankshaft. Compared with the prior art, the invention has the advantages of accurate seed taking, high positive bud , more reasonable machine operation and suitability for uneven terrains.

Technical Field
The invention relates to the field of agricultural equipment, in particular to a novel traction type garlic seeder.
Background
The garlic is a long-used material object seasoning, has high utilization value and is suitable for large-area planting. With the development of technology, automatic machines are becoming more and more popular, and in the aspect of garlic sowing, mechanized sowing machines are already appeared, but the functions are relatively lacking, so that people still rely on manual garlic planting, and the manual garlic planting is time-consuming and labor-consuming. The effect of uneven row spacing and plant spacing of artificial planting is also poor, and the cost is also higher. Therefore, an efficient and accurate garlic seeder is urgently needed to effectively speed up garlic seeding so as to promote the modernization development of the garlic industry.

The working principle of the invention is as follows: after the garlic seeds are poured into the garlic box, a part of the garlic seeds enter a garlic seed stopping area through a garlic blocking plate, the garlic blocking plate is used for controlling the flow of the garlic seeds in the garlic box, the garlic seeds are jacked up by a seed taking device after entering the garlic seed stopping area, then are brushed into a garlic guiding groove by a garlic sowing brush, a disturbance plate is arranged in the garlic seed stopping area when the seed taking device moves to the lower end, the garlic seeds are moved once, the phenomenon of overhead formation of garlic seed plates is avoided, the seeds can be effectively taken out when the seed taking device works up and down, the garlic seeds enter a first duckbill through a garlic guiding pipe after entering the garlic guiding groove, the first duckbill is in a round and flat shape at the lower end, the garlic seeds are kept in a lying state, when the first duckbill is pushed and opened by a cylinder, the garlic seeds enter a second duckbill, the second duckbill is in a conical shape, the garlic seeds become upright shape, and part of the garlic seeds return to bud upwards, when the second duckbill is pushed and opened by the cylinder, the garlic seeds enter a third duckbill, the third duckbill is in a conical shape, the lower end of the third duck bill is provided with a hook, when the fourth duck bill is moved to the third duck bill from the crankshaft, the upper opening of the fourth duck bill can touch the round hook of the lower opening of the third duck bill and also can touch the garlic whisker to adjust the head of the garlic seed, the third duck bill is returned by a spring after opening, if the garlic seed of the third duck bill is returned to the bottom, the fourth duck bill can not touch the garlic seed, the direction of the fourth duck bill can not be changed, the garlic seed can continuously fall into the fourth duck bill, the fourth duck bill is pushed by a cylinder to open the opening when moved to the soil by the crankshaft, the garlic seed is sowed into the soil, compacted by a soil pressing wheel, the soil is moisturized to ensure that the garlic seed buds , the four layers of duck bills are respectively in 2-4 layers of cross openings and closed, 1-2-3 layers are in a fixed state, only the fourth duck bill is in a moving state, the upper end of the seed extractor is provided with an exhaust pipe, the air suction pipe is linked, the exhaust fan is linked again, the upper end of the seed extractor can be designed into a smaller concave surface with suction force, no matter the size of the garlic seeds, only one garlic seed can be extracted each time, all cylinder air sources are provided by an air pump, the air pump and an exhaust fan are provided by a power output shaft of a rotary cultivator, the power of the rotary cultivator is provided by a tractor, a round hole of a lifting pull rod of the tractor is changed into a long hole when the tractor is linked with the rotary cultivator, as shown in the figure, the front and the rear of the seeder are respectively provided with a sowing depth adjusting wheel, which is also a power wheel of the seeder, the rotary cultivator is linked with the seeder by adopting a parallelogram principle, thus the up and down adjustment of the seeder can be ensured, the level is unchanged, the power of the seeder is provided by a front driving wheel and a soil pressing wheel together, because a crankshaft is in unbalanced movement, the fourth duckbill can not smoothly run, the seed extractor is linked with one end of the fourth duckbill in the reverse direction of a crankshaft, when the seed extractor moves up and down, the force in the opposite direction can be applied to the fourth duckbilled, the problem of partial unbalance of the crankshaft is solved, and as the fourth duckbilled is heavier than the seed extractor, the counterweight can be properly added on the seed extractor to keep the balanced motion of the crankshaft, so that the machine operates more stably, the disturbance plate is applied by the spring, the spring is tensioned when the seed extractor moves up and down, the trigger is touched when the seed extractor moves to the lower end, the spring rebounds instantly, the disturbance plate swings to have explosive force, the garlic seeds can be disturbed in the original overhead state, the swing amplitude of the disturbance plate is very small, the damage of the garlic seeds can not be caused, the garlic seeds are uniform, after the fourth duckbilled is used for sowing the garlic seeds into soil, the garlic seeds are compacted by the soil compacting wheel, and the garlic seeds are only beneficial to the growth of the garlic seeds after the soft soil is compacted by the soil compacting wheel.
